Output 66c397460147052fdb680ddd7fe6b4e0139c1e1cb8bb6279f12bd61352fac99b:8
- value
- 20411062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b509ec4a3002fa61142216e5975b3230ba33218 OP_EQUAL
- address
- MDJngLW4pngQJcgYVJa5JgWAEEgYqBPi1m
- transaction
- 66c397460147052fdb680ddd7fe6b4e0139c1e1cb8bb6279f12bd61352fac99b
- spent
- true